  4. Release 2.6.6 beta is now available and may be downloaded immediately. WARNING: Release 2.6.6 contains a BUG, and therefore should only be used for WSDK support purposes! This release includes the final version of WSDK 1.0 . For fixes and enhancements, please peruse our beta forum at http://forum.universal-devices.com/viewtopic.php?t=930. You may also post your comments/questions and issues relating to 2.6.6 to the same forum. IMPORTANT 1. For those upgrading from release 2.6, please note that releases 2.6.1 and above will use default HTTP/HTTPS ports of 80/443 respectively. As such, before upgrading Disable Internet Access 2. If you have used bookmarks, please update them accordingly. If you have problems finding ISY, try http://www.universal-devices.com/99i 3. If you are upgrading from 2.6.1, please make sure you export all your programs and store them in a safe place 4. As always, please take a backup of your ISY Due to massive changes in this release, please do be kind enough to thoroughly test those functions most important to you specifically schedules, triggers, and Web Services. INSTRUCTIONS - Userid = isy - Password = autoupdate - For ISY-26, download the update from http://www.universal-devices.com/update ... nsteon.zip do not unzip - For ISY-99i Series, download the update from http://www.universal-devices.com/update ... nsteon.zip do not unzip - Login to Admin Console - Choose Help->Manually Upgrade My Lighting and choose the file you downloaded in the previous step - Choose Help->Manually Upgrade My Lighting and choose the file you downloaded in the previous step - Important: After upgrading, please close Admin Console, close all web browser processes, clear your Java cache, and reopen Admin Console. If there are any web browser processes running, the Java cache will not be cleared. LIMITATIONS - IES Touchscreens will not work with this release. Update is forthcoming - InterfaceGo will not work with this release. Update is forthcoming - WSDK requires many modifications to work with this release
  5. jswedberg, First and foremost, please DISABLE the port forwarding on port 80 immediately. This is a security risk as others can sniff your credentials. Please only use HTTPS (port 443) for remote access. File->Enable Internet Access attempts to do what you have already done (automatically). As such, you are all set; please do not worry about File->Enable Internet Access. With kind regards, Michel

  9. Hello schenkl, You can use our JSDK and WSDK (web services) to write network applications that talk with ISY over the network. JSDK is pretty well established, is in Java and is released with each official release. WSDK is ISY services in WSDL, is brand new, and the first version of which shall be released in a couple of days. If you have specific questions vis-a-vis developing applications for ISY, please do be kind enough to visit our developers forum: http://forum.universal-devices.com/viewforum.php?f=2 . With kind regards, Michel

  11. Hello Candide, As far as Managed By, it only means that they are both controllers for the same scene. But, they are not linked to one another (since they are controllers only). As far as the blinking, would you make sure that all the devices in your scene respond? It may well be possible that one (or more) of devices in your scene (button 3) are not responding and thus the blinking. With kind regards, Michel
